# Superclient Python

A Python library for automatically optimizing Kafka producer configurations based on topic-specific recommendations.

## Overview

Superstream Clients works as a Python import hook that intercepts Kafka producer creation and applies optimized configurations without requiring any code changes in your application. It dynamically retrieves optimization recommendations from Superstream and applies them based on impact analysis.

### Required Environment Variables

- `SUPERSTREAM_TOPICS_LIST`: Comma-separated list of topics your application produces to

### Optional Environment Variables

- `SUPERSTREAM_LATENCY_SENSITIVE`: Set to "true" to prevent any modification to linger.ms values
- `SUPERSTREAM_DISABLED`: Set to "true" to disable optimization
- `SUPERSTREAM_DEBUG`: Set to "true" to enable debug logs

Example:
```bash
export SUPERSTREAM_TOPICS_LIST=orders,payments,user-events
export SUPERSTREAM_LATENCY_SENSITIVE=true
```
